*For plan purposes, a domestic partner means: 
Two unmarried adults at least 18 years of age of the same or opposite sex that are not related by blood that have lived together for more than six months in an exclusive committed relationship of mutual caring and financial support.  Dependent benefits for domestic partners are available under the medical, dental and vision plans. An affidavit will be required if you elect to cover a domestic partner under your medical, dental, and or vision plans.
